  2. ? - Cancer can spread anywhere in the body. Pancreatic cancer is divided into four stages:

    Small and localised (stage one).
    Spread into surrounding structures (stages two or three).
    Spread into other parts of the body (stage four).

    If the cancer has spread to distant parts of the body this is known as secondary cancer (or metastatic cancer).
